5 Ways Giving Back Actually Helps Your Business

Companies of all shapes and sizes have the resources to provide a positive impact in their communities. Whether it’s by supporting a local charity, organizing an event or participating in a fundraiser, giving back has important benefits for a business well beyond helping out the local community.

Here are 5 ways giving back actually helps your business.

Employees reap the benefits:

Giving back helps the charity, but it also helps the employees who work for you.  When philanthropy is ingrained in the company culture, employees are more likely to rate their position  as a positive experience.. Employees respect companies that care for their community -it simply raises morale, and increases loyalty to their employer.

It helps society:

By making connections within the community, it ultimately helps society become better as a whole.  The less fortunate benefit from your donations, and it gets everyone involved in making positive changes.

When you give back to the community, it not only reflects your values, but your commitment towards improving society. It encourages people to volunteer:

A number of companies recognize the value in giving back, even offering employees paid time off to volunteer. Some companies have even led thousands of volunteer activities inspired by its employees, including raising money for cancer research or building homes for veterans in need.

It gives them recognition:

A community-oriented company with a charitable mindset can benefit from positive PR, good employee morale and increased connections which can aid in long-term financial success.
